Sr Account Manager Distribution - East Coast

<div><p><b>Sr Account Manager Distribution - East Coast</b></p><p></p><p><b>YOUR ROLE</b></p><p>This position focuses on managing major transportation OEM and harness maker accounts with support of regional distributors. The ideal candidate will possess proven experience in growing customer book of business, strategies and problem solving, with a strong focus on customer satisfaction. Candidate is expected to act with sense of urgency and provide timely follow up to all customer inquiries. Excellent communication skills, self-confidence, and ability to strengthen the customer relationship and intimacy are a must.</p><p></p><p>In your daily job you will:</p><p></p><ul><li>Lead account growth while managing the customer relationships and voice of the customer.</li><li>Create customer strategies through detailed value propositions maximizing booking, revenue and profitability achieving Aptiv metric and objectives.</li><li>Lead resolution of customer commercial disputes (recognized as Aptiv’s customer lead).</li><li>Establish proactive communication and relationship that promotes confidence and trust.</li><li>Ensure customer demands are managed through the appropriate internal processes such that all responses are made timely, within and consistent with our commercial policy.</li><li>Create and drive deployment of strategic plan for the account.</li><li>Interacting with the customer purchasing, engineering and program management teams.</li><li>Identify business development opportunities.</li><li>Coordinates and monitors pricing, quotations, business proposals and ‘win-or-lose’ feedback.</li><li>Responsibility for the preparation and physical presentations provided to customers that are related to all aspects of the business account (Technical and Commercial).</li></ul><p></p><p></p><p><b>YOUR BACKGROUND</b></p><p></p><p>Key skills and competencies for succeeding in this role are:</p><p></p><p><b>Must Haves (Minimum Qualifications):</b></p><p></p><ul><li>5+ years experience working in the electronic components industry.</li><li>Bachelor's degree in Business or Engineering or equivalent degree.</li><li>Ability to forge customer relationships with purchasing, engineering, & business teams of our customers.</li><li>Persistence to achieve revenue & profit goals.</li><li>Ability to compile and present business cases for leadership approval.</li><li>Business acumen including negotiation skills and understanding of financial business cases.</li><li>Self-starter in learning the CS product portfolio and unique design features' value proposition for communication with customers. – (ability to diff products) application and design.</li><li>Proven ability to work autonomously, manage large & varied work load, set priorities and close.</li><li>Ability to read a production print and answer basic product questions without involving engineering.</li><li>Enough technical competence to be able to present the CS product portfolio to customers without engineering or product line manager involvement.</li><li>Ability to answer basic product performance questions (current rating, voltage range, temperature range, etc.).</li><li>Travel required 50%.</li></ul><p></p><p><b>Nice to Haves (Preferred Qualifications): </b></p><ul><li>Master's degree in Business Administration or Engineering or Equivalent degree</li><li>8+ years’ experience working in the electronic components industry.</li><li>Long term agreements.
